About The Position

The Process Manager will provide standardized training and development for the operations department companywide. This position will be remote but will service the entire US Final Mile operations. Core Responsibilities & Duties: Supporting of our Final Mile Field Operations Ride Behinds Site visits Observe, monitor and analyze each location operations personnel by position; determine best practices and document the processes and procedures for each position. Conduct follow-up visits to each location to evaluate and measure results of training to ensure assigned processes and procedures are being followed. Actively search, design and implement effective methods to educate, enhance performance and recognize performance. Perform location audits of all assigned locations. Work with Regional Operations Managers and Director for the effective development, coordination and presentation of training and development programs for all operations employees. Work effectively as a team member with other members of management and human resources. Manage freight claims by working with location Managers, document, and update accordingly. Ability to travel extensively- up to 75% travel. Perform other duties and tasks assigned
